Eep. To c/r 3-bet and make you face two bets indicates SB is probably a decent player, who is paying attention to the fact that UTG is nuts and you are capable of folding. Following those lines, SB probably holds AJ-QJ and fears overcards, or he's on a flush draw. I would think trips-good-kicker would wait for a non-scary turn rather than make you face two cold on the flop, and a boat is unlikely. I guess it just makes me think you still have at least 25% equity in this pot.

This analysis is all too complicated to do in the heat of the moment, and I honestly would have folded.

However, if you continue, call and prepare to c/r SB on a non-scary turn, putting 2 to UTG and hoping for a cheap showdown. Fold to a 3-bet or 2 bets on the river.
